With a lifetime of teaching, some 25 books and several TV series and videos behind him, Alwyn is pretty much the granddaddy of art instruction. It’s no accident that his books have all been bestsellers or that he was one of Daler Rowney’s most popular demonstrators. Alwyn can not only walk the walk, he can tell you how he does it, too.
All of which preamble says that this is a book you’re going to want. It’s slightly less technical than some of the other volumes in the series and there’s always a sense that you’re seeing ideas in practice rather than just in theory. There are more demonstration pages here, too.
The subject matter is pretty much confined to landscapes because Alwyn never tries to work outside what he knows best. He still finds room for tips on skies, trees, water, people, boats and everything else you’d expect from him.
